Smart Medical Devices
SMARTdrill 6.0
smartmeddevices.com
Conventional techniques for drilling bone and placing screws in
orthopedic surgery have their drawbacks — specifically, they
involve a lot of trial and error, guesswork, safety risks and, potential-
ly, waste. SMARTdrill 6.0 seeks to solve this problem — and reduce
the number of steps to place surgical hardware — with digital tech-
nology. It provides surgeons with real-time drilling data and drill bit
location, which can inform clinical decisions and choice of implant
hardware. The company says it reduces drill and screw plunge and
accurately measures depth, torque and energy in real time, present-
ing data to the surgeon via a graphical user interface.
